Screen over the Chantry of Henry the Fifth, plate O from 'Westminster Abbey'

(Screen over the Chantry of Henry the Fifth, plate O from 'Westminster Abbey', engraved by J. Bluck (fl.1791-1831) pub. by Rudolph Ackermann (1764-1834) 1812 (aquatint))


Frederick (after) Mackenzie
